Narrative
A pre-frontal trough followed by a potent cold front caused multiple severe thunderstorms and isolated flash flooding in portions of Southeast New York. A man was injured by a lightning strike at cricket field near Avenue S and East 32nd Street. Wires and large tree limbs were reported down at the intersection of Pitkin Avenue and Hawtree Street. Penny size hail was reported in Howard Beach. A man was injured when a tree fell on his car near the intersection of 164th Street and Underhill Avenue. Penny Size hail was reported in Jamaica. A tree was reported down on Bell Boulevard between 56th Avenue and 58th Avenue. Trees and wires were reported down at 215-90 50th Avenue. Tree down near the intersection of the Cross Island Parkway and the Long Island Expressway. A tree was reported down at the intersection of Perth Road and 188th Street. Quarter size hail was reported in northeastern portions of the Bronx. A funnel cloud was reported. Hail up to quarter size was reported in the Bayside section of Queens. Hail up to quarter size was reported in the Baybridge Condominiums in the Bayside section of Queens. FDR Drive was closed at 116th St. due to flooding. Six inches of standing water accumulated at the intersection of W. 46th St. and Broadway.
